Position Overview :

Location : Flower Mound, TX or Norwalk, CT

The Portfolio Manager is responsible managing a portfolio of commercial floorplan dealers and vendor partners across truck, trailer, construction, and specialty vehicle segments supporting the Inventory Finance portfolio of dealers located in Canada.

The Portfolio Manager will consistently deliver exceptional service levels while concurrently ensuring robust portfolio control.

The role is keenly focused on the areas of risk mitigation and collections, as well as acting as a front-facing representative of the company.

The Portfolio Manager will lead coordination of the inventory inspection (floorplan audit) function and be the primary contact with the field auditors, including review and analysis of results and irregularities.

The Portfolio Manager will spearhead the collection of all dealer accounts including principal, interest, curtailments, and maturities.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ities :

Provide exceptional customer service to dealer and manufacturer partners. Interface as necessary to resolve operational issues or concerns and provide support for various inquiries.

Collaborate and effectively communicate with Mitsubishi staff members across USA and Canada as needed.

  • Interact with dealers & manufacturers via phone and email to handle all aspects of account management and customer service.
  • Act as the primary contact for the ongoing inventory inspection process performed by a given audit provider. Lead reconciliation of inspection results with dealers, identify areas of concern, and ensure the Wholesale system accurately reflects collateral status and that collection notes are up to date.

Communicate with audit providers as necessary to address special requests and service-related concerns.

Lead collection activity and portfolio management with consistent operational cadence. Initiate contact with delinquent dealers with appropriate frequency to resolve issues and secure payments.

Identify and escalate problematic situations as they arise, communicating frequently with the Funding & Operations Manager and the Risk Department

  • Leverage the Wholesale system to fully document all dealer related activities, conversations, and correspondence in a timely manner.
  • Obtain and forward all necessary documents for requests to modify curtailments and maturities to the Credit team.
  • Collaborate closely with the Funding & Operations Manager to meet or exceed monthly portfolio KPI’s. including, Total SAU (1.

75% or less), Aged SAU / 30+ days (1.00% or less), Current Interest Collections (95% or higher), Past Due Curtailments (2% or less).

This high level of communication will serve to proactively mitigate risk while identifying potential problems and to communicate regularly regarding portfolio control issues and non-performing dealers.

  • Coordinate with Funding & Operations Manager on escalated and sensitive collection activity including demand and default notices, repossessions, and commencement of legal action if necessary.
